NIOB to Host Mentorship Programme for Students, Professionals

Bldr Daniel Kolade (right), the NIOB President, during his investiture ceremony


The Nigerian Institute of Building (NIOB) has announced a mentorship and capacity-building programme for students, early-career professionals, and probationers in the building sector.


Bldr Daniel Kolade, the NIOB President, during his investiture ceremony, disclosed that the initiative springs from the realisation that the future of the building profession lies in the hands of young builders.


Highlighting his administration’s plans, he elaborated, “This administration will intensify capacity development and mentorship programmes, targeted at students, probationers, and early-career professionals.”


He added, “We will strengthen our collaboration with the National Board for Technical Education and training institutions on Recognition of Prior Learning skills acquisition, and competency certification.”


The president noted that the institute will strengthen its partnership in skills development with agencies such as the Nigerian Correctional Service.
